"Nowhere on Earth is there a greater cause of uncertainty in sea level rise projections than from East Antarctica, in Australia's backyard," the statement says.
"The East Antarctic ice sheet alone holds enough water to raise global sea levels by approximately 50 metres if completely melted.
"Implications for our coastal cities and infrastructure are immense."
